How Much Fragrance Oil To Add To Coconut Wax. Generally speaking, 10% is a good starting point for most types of wax. You can add 1 oz to 1.6 oz of fragrance oil per pound of wax. I hate to say this but not all fragrance oils are created equally! Fragrance oil loads for coconut wax go up to 11%, however, it is suggested that you use no more than a 10% fragrance oil load.
